Svalbard: The Most Recommended Trips for Friends in December

December in Svalbard offers a magical Arctic experience, transforming the archipelago into a winter wonderland with its dark skies illuminated by the Northern Lights. For friends seeking adventure, relaxation, and unique experiences, December provides an array of activities that capture the essence of the Arctic winter.


One of the most enchanting experiences in December is witnessing the Northern Lights. With polar nights in full swing, the extended darkness provides ample opportunity to see the aurora borealis. Specialized Northern Lights tours take you to the best viewing spots away from the artificial light of Longyearbyen. Cozying up in thermal gear, friends can marvel at the dancing lights in the sky, which range from delicate green hues to vibrant pinks and purples. The spectacle of the aurora against the stark, snow-covered landscape creates a truly magical atmosphere.


December is also a fantastic time to embark on a snowmobile adventure. The snow-covered terrain offers the perfect backdrop for snowmobiling, allowing friends to explore remote areas and enjoy the tranquility of the Arctic wilderness. Guided snowmobile tours often include stops at scenic viewpoints and historical sites, providing both adventure and insight into Svalbard’s unique environment and history. The crisp winter air and the thrill of speeding across the snow make this a highlight of any December visit.


For those seeking a more tranquil experience, dog sledding in December is a must. The snow-covered landscape is ideal for this traditional Arctic mode of travel. Friends can enjoy the thrill of gliding across the snow while being pulled by a team of enthusiastic sled dogs. This experience not only offers excitement but also a glimpse into the history and culture of Arctic travel.


Exploring Svalbard's ice caves is another captivating activity. The early winter ice formations create stunning cave structures that can be explored with the help of experienced guides. The caves, illuminated by headlamps, reveal intricate ice formations and patterns, creating a surreal and beautiful environment. This adventure offers a unique way to experience the Arctic’s icy beauty up close.


December is also a great time for wildlife enthusiasts to visit Svalbard. While polar bears are more challenging to spot in the snow-covered landscape, other Arctic wildlife such as reindeer and seals can be seen in their winter habitats. Wildlife tours guided by experts provide the opportunity to observe these animals in their natural environment, offering a deeper understanding of Arctic ecosystems.


In Longyearbyen, friends can enjoy the cozy atmosphere of local lodges and restaurants. The town, beautifully decorated for the holidays, offers a warm and inviting ambiance. After a day of exploration, friends can gather around a fire, enjoy hearty Arctic cuisine, and share stories of their adventures. Local cuisine, including dishes like reindeer stew and Arctic char, provides a taste of the region’s unique flavors.


Cultural experiences in December include visiting the Svalbard Museum and local art galleries. The museum offers insights into Svalbard’s history and the challenges of Arctic living, while art galleries showcase local artists and crafts inspired by the Arctic environment. These cultural experiences provide a richer understanding of life in this remote part of the world.


For those interested in Arctic research, a visit to local research stations can be enlightening. Tours often include discussions with scientists about their work and the challenges facing the Arctic environment. This educational component adds depth to the trip, highlighting the importance of ongoing research and conservation efforts.


December in Svalbard offers an array of experiences that cater to different interests, from thrilling adventures to serene natural beauty and cultural exploration. The combination of winter landscapes, Northern Lights, and unique Arctic activities makes this a memorable time to visit with friends. Whether seeking excitement or relaxation, December in Svalbard provides an unforgettable Arctic adventure.
